OHR RTRS News Summary, 2 May 2000

News Headlines

  • High Representative Wolfgang Petritsch discusses work of BiH common institutions with members of the BiH Presidency
  • RS Finance Minister Novak Kondic meets with IMF delegation from its Resident Mission Office to BiH
  • Payment of February 2000 pensions expected in one month’s time – RS Pension Fund Director Svetozar Mihajlovic
  • Continuation of 10th session of RS Assembly to be held in Banja Luka on 3 May
  • Brcko District Government adopts 2000 budget
  • OSCE supports decision of 34 officials to resign from positions in public enterprises
  • OHR and UNHCR support extension of deadline for submission of apartment return claims in BiH Federation
  • BiH would have received significantly more funding at recent Brussels Donors Conference if it had common project with Croatia – Prlic
  • Children of Bosniak returnees to Stolac Municipal attend school together with Croat children – OHR
  • OHR opens office in Livno due to the slow implementation of Dayton Peace Agreement in that municipality
  • Serbs from Kosovo and Metohija will not participate in population census unless displaced Serbs return – Kosovska Mitrovica Serb Nation Council President Oliver Ivanovic at meeting with OSCE delegation
  • KFOR wounds Zoran Milic, a Kosovo Serb, who was drunk and refused to stop at a KFOR checkpoint
  • Shots taken at KFOR Greek military bus near Decani village, Kosovo
  • Bomb thrown at offices of Yugoslav Committee for Cooperation with UN Civilian Mission to Kosovo and Metohija in Kosovska Mitrovica
  • KFOR arrests three Telekom Srbije engineers
  • German Lower Saxony Interior Minister Bartling says that Kosovo Albanian refugees in Germany must return to Kosovo
  • Three Orthodox churches in western Macedonia demolished over the Easter holidays
  • 87 journalists killed throughout the world, including 25 in Yugoslavia, 16 of them during NATO air-strike on RTS building in Belgrade – International Institute for Media
  • Senior UN officials announce Charter on Press Freedom on occasion of International Free Press Day
